Let's dig into your situation a bit. So, I get your primary concerns are erectile dysfunction and premature ejaculation, which can feel pretty overwhelming, right? It’s natural to start wondering if other health issues like piles might be causing these problems, but typically, piles aren't directly responsible for ED or premature ejaculation. However, the stress and discomfort from piles can indirectly affect your sexual health. In Ayurveda, these conditions are often related to imbalances in Vata dosha, possibly impacting the nervous system and Prana Vayu – the energy governing your mind and senses. Also, digestive health, your agni (digestive fire), plays a big role here; if digestion is sluggish, this can sap your vitality. For you, Ashwagandha is a big recommendation, it's like the star of Ayurveda. This herb can strengthen and balance Vata, boost your stamina, and help with stress. Try taking it in powder form, around 5 grams mixed with warm milk, twice daily. Another useful remedy is Shilajit, renowned for enhancing sexual vitality. Look for a purified form and consult a local practitioner to know the exact dosage; Shilajit can be real potent. Don't forget the importance of diet and lifestyle. Fresh, warm meals soothe Vata. Avoid cold, stale foods. A spoon of ghee in your daily meals might work wonders for lubrication. Simple yoga postures like Vajrasana after meals enhance digestion and boost energy flow. Also, work on a regular sleep pattern, stress management through meditation, and don’t ignore physical activity. Check in with a healthcare professional, especially for a physical exam – sometimes conditions get too complex for self-treatment alone. Be patient too; Ayurveda is more of a marathon, not a sprint!
